A method for synthesizing l-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t
By reacting L-glutamic acid with tert-butyl acetate to generate intermediate A, followed by hydrolysis in the presence of magnesium salt, the high cost of synthesizing L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t in existing technologies has been solved, enabling efficient and low-cost industrial production.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The application relates to a synthesis method of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t and belongs to the technical field of organic synthesis. BACKGROUND
[0002] L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t is a modified amino acid derivative, which can be used as a key intermediate or building block in polypeptide or protein synthesis, can effectively realize the regional selectivity control of the reaction, and can ensure the high efficiency and accuracy of the synthesis process. The compound has important application value in medical research and development and biochemical research, for example, is used for efficiently and selectively constructing specific polypeptide sequences or proteins containing glutamic acid residues. However, there is no report on the synthesis process of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t in the prior art, especially a synthesis method suitable for industrial production. SUMMARY
[0003] In order to solve the above problems, the purpose of the present application is to provide a synthesis method of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t, which has mild reaction conditions, simple operation, low cost, high yield and is suitable for large-scale production.
[0004] In order to achieve the above purpose, the technical scheme of the present application is as follows:
[0005] A synthesis method of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t, comprising the following steps:
[0006] (1) using L-glutamic acid as a starting material, reacting in the presence of an acidic catalyst in tert-butyl acetate to obtain L-glutamic acid di-tert-butyl ester (denoted as intermediate A).
[0007] The amount of tert-butyl acetate is 8-10 times the volume of the mass of L-glutamic acid.
[0008] The acidic catalyst is a mixed acid of perchloric acid and concentrated sulfuric acid (mass ratio of not less than 98% sulfuric acid aqueous solution), wherein the amount of perchloric acid is 0.8-2 equivalents (based on L-glutamic acid), and the amount of concentrated sulfuric acid is 0.8-2 equivalents (based on L-glutamic acid).
[0009] (2) performing selective hydrolysis reaction on the intermediate A obtained in step (1) in the presence of a magnesium salt to obtain L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ester magnesium salt.
[0010] The magnesium salt is magnesium sulfate, and the amount thereof is 1.0-2.0 equivalents (based on L-glutamic acid); the solvent used in the hydrolysis reaction is one or more of water and ethanol; preferably a mixed solvent of water and ethanol, wherein the amount of ethanol is 0.6-2 times the volume of the mass of L-glutamic acid.

[0013] The beneficial effects of the present application are:
[0014] 1. The present application uses inexpensive and readily available L-glutamic acid as a starting material to synthesize intermediate A, avoiding the purchase of more expensive intermediate A, effectively reducing production costs.
[0015] 2. The present application completes two-step reactions by one-pot method, selectively removes a single tert-butyl group through unique conditions to obtain the target compound, has high operation feasibility, and is easy to produce.
[0016] 3. The present application realizes high selectivity retention of 5-tert-butyl ester through magnesium salt mediated selective hydrolysis reaction, has less by-products, and has strong controllability.
[0017] 4. The present application has mild reaction conditions, simple and safe operation, only needs crystallization and filtration for post-treatment, does not need complex purification, by-products are easy to remove, has high product yield (can reach more than 64%), high purity (≥97%), and is suitable for industrial production. [0024] Example 1
[0025] (1) L-glutamic acid (14.7 g, 0.1 mol) and tert-butyl acetate (10 V, 147 mL) were added to a four-necked flask and cooled to 0±5℃ under nitrogen protection. After stirring for 30 minutes, perchloric acid (20.0 g, 0.2 mol) and concentrated sulfuric acid (7.84 g, 0.08 mol) were added sequentially. The reaction was maintained at 0±5℃ for 16 hours, and the reaction progress was monitored by ELSD. When the content of intermediate A was ≥90% and the remaining raw material was ≤2%, sodium hydroxide aqueous solution (80 mL) was added to quench the reaction, and the mixture was stirred at 20±5℃ for 0.5 hours. The pH was adjusted to 4~5 with sodium hydroxide aqueous solution. Then, the tert-butyl acetate was removed by concentration in a water bath at 40℃ to obtain an aqueous solution of intermediate A.
[0026] (2) Add ethanol (0.6 V, 8.8 mL) and magnesium sulfate (18.0 g, 0.15 mol) to the aqueous solution of intermediate A obtained in step (1), add water until the system is clear, and keep the reaction at 50±5℃ for 16 hours. When ELSD monitoring shows that the target compound is ≥90% and intermediate A is ≤2%, cool the reaction system to 0±5℃ to crystallize, keep it at the temperature and stir for 0.5~1 hours, filter, wash the filter cake with water (150 mL), and dry it at room temperature to obtain 15.8 g of white solid (i.e., magnesium salt of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ester), with a yield of 69.91% and a purity of 99.17% as determined by ELSD (see the chromatogram for details). Figure 1 ).
[0027] Example 2
[0028] (1) Add L-glutamic acid (50 g, 0.34 mol) and tert-butyl acetate (9 V, 450 mL) to a four-necked flask and cool to 0±5℃ under nitrogen protection. After stirring for 30 minutes, add perchloric acid (48.8 g, 0.34 mol) and concentrated sulfuric acid (33.30 g, 0.34 mol) sequentially. Maintain the temperature at 0±5℃ for 16 hours and monitor the reaction progress by ELSD. When the content of intermediate A is ≥90% and the remaining raw material is ≤2%, add sodium hydroxide aqueous solution (100~200 mL) to quench the reaction, stir at 20±5℃ for 0.5 hours, and adjust the pH to 4~5 with sodium hydroxide aqueous solution. Then concentrate in a water bath at 40℃ to remove tert-butyl acetate, and obtain an aqueous solution of intermediate A.
[0029] (2) Add ethanol (1.6 V, 80 mL) and magnesium sulfate (40.8 g, 0.34 mol) to the aqueous solution of intermediate A obtained in step (1), add water until the system is clear, and keep the reaction at 50±5℃ for 16 hours. When ELSD monitoring shows that the target compound is ≥90% and intermediate A is ≤2%, cool the reaction system to 0±5℃ to crystallize, keep it at the temperature and stir for 0.5~1 hours, filter, wash the filter cake with water (400 mL), and dry it at room temperature to obtain 53.8 g of white solid (i.e., magnesium salt of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ester), with a yield of 70.00% and a purity of 99.93% as determined by ELSD (see the chromatogram). Figure 2 ).
[0030] Example 3
[0031] (1) L-glutamic acid (14.7 g, 0.1 mol) and tert-butyl acetate (8 V, 117.6 mL) were added to a four-necked flask and cooled to 0±5℃ under nitrogen protection. After stirring for 30 minutes, perchloric acid (8.0 g, 0.08 mol) and concentrated sulfuric acid (19.6 g, 0.2 mol) were added sequentially. The reaction was maintained at 0±5℃ for 16 hours, and the reaction progress was monitored by ELSD. When the content of intermediate A was ≥90% and the remaining raw material was ≤2%, sodium hydroxide aqueous solution (80 mL) was added to quench the reaction, and the mixture was stirred at 20±5℃ for 0.5 hours. The pH was adjusted to 4~5 with sodium hydroxide aqueous solution. Then, the tert-butyl acetate was removed by concentration in a water bath at 40℃ to obtain an aqueous solution of intermediate A.
[0032] (2) Add ethanol (2 V, 29.4 mL) and magnesium sulfate (24.0 g, 0.2 mol) to the aqueous solution of intermediate A obtained in step (1), add water until the system is clear, and keep the reaction at 50±5℃ for 16 hours. When ELSD monitoring shows that the target compound is ≥90% and intermediate A is ≤2%, cool the reaction system to 0±5℃ to crystallize, keep it at the temperature and stir for 0.5~1 hours, filter, wash the filter cake with water (150 mL), and dry it at room temperature to obtain 14.5 g of white solid (i.e., magnesium salt of L-glutamic acid-5-tert-butyl ester), with a yield of 64.15% and a purity of 97.84% as determined by ELSD (see the chromatogram). Figure 3 ).
